Description

The Letter for closing bank account after death without nomination in Middlesex is a formal communication used to notify a bank about the closure of a deceased person's bank account. This model letter assists legal representatives, such as attorneys and paralegals, in gathering necessary information regarding the decedent's assets, such as bank accounts, certificates of deposit, and safe deposit boxes. Key features include requesting a detailed list of accounts held by the decedent, the dates they were opened or closed, and the costs associated with obtaining copies of statements. Users must fill in specific details such as the decedent's name, date of death, and account information. This form is particularly useful for those handling estates, as it streamlines the process of asset inventory and ensures compliance with legal requirements after a person's death. Legal professionals can edit the letter to fit particular circumstances and facts, making it versatile for various cases. Your valid ID, such as a state-issued driver's license or ID card, U.S. passport, or military ID. Proof of death, such as certified copies of the death certificate. Documentation about the account and its owner, including the deceased's full legal name, Social Security number, and the bank account number.

If there's a will without a named executor, the court will issue a Letter of Testamentary; if there's no will, the court will issue a Letter of Administration. Present either of these letters to the bank along with the death certificate to close the account.

Ans : - In a deceased account where there is neither Survivorship clause nor Nomination, Bank delivers the assets only to the legal heirs of the deceased.
